A Simple Key For erc20 address generator Unveiled

No validity checking is completed over the host identify both. If addr specifies an IPv4 address an instance of Inet4Address will be returned; if not, an instance of Inet6Address might be returned. IPv4 address byte array need to be 4 bytes very long and IPv6 byte array should be 16 bytes prolonged

A vanity address is a unique personalized address. It really is an address which has portions of it picked out instead of currently being generated at random.

The best way that s is chosen also issues immensely concerning its cryptographic safety. Basically, It's not necessarily advisable to pick this secret exponent yourself or come up with any kind of intelligent approach as you may for just a password (aka brain wallet) as innumerable this kind of approaches are already used for decades to crack techniques applying numerous algorithms and Personal computer application, including All those accustomed to crack passwords. Hence, The trick exponent ought to be generated using a cryptographically-secure pseudo-random number generator (CSPRNG) such as the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I'm considered one of twelve contributors to that spec on Github), so that there's considerably more unlikely a chance that an attacker could forecast that price, because the random bits that make up that number are sourced from different sites from your local unit, and from processes that do not transmit that entropy facts on line (assuming the program that you are utilizing is safe in addition to a Safe and sound CSPRNG). Instance Python code:

Actions: EOAs can conduct steps explicitly allowed because of the consumer. They're able to transfer cash, interact with contracts, and initiate many transactions depending on the person’s intentions.

When an address is stored from the EVM, it is actually initially hashed using the Keccak-256 hashing algorithm. The hash is then accustomed to discover the corresponding department within the state trie.

As is often observed in the above implementation I wrote, the 6 methods to go from private important to ethereum address is often summarized as follows:

We’ll also address the distinctive qualities of different address forms and share most effective practices for managing your Ethereum addresses.

An identifier for a set Go for Details of interfaces (commonly belonging to different nodes). A packet sent to your multicast address is sent to all interfaces recognized by that address.

Take a look at our State-of-the-art blockchain bootcamp now and turn into a blockchain developer who is aware the challenging stuff other coders Never.

The zero address is usually a Distinctive address that really should not be useful for any intent in addition to those listed above. For those who send Ether to the zero address or endeavor to produce a agreement or connect with a agreement with the zero address, you will lose your funds or your transaction will are unsuccessful.

Manage: EOAs are controlled by consumers, that means that people have Regulate around the private keys associated with their EOAs. In contrast, agreement accounts are controlled through the logic in the sensible agreement code. The code defines The principles and habits on the agreement account.

Interact with a contract at the zero address: Any transaction that tries to interact with a deal for the zero address will fall short.

This may be used to guard person privacy over the Ethereum blockchain by enabling users to establish that they've sure property with no revealing the specific quantities or addresses.

 Initializing the wallet will usually current you which has a magic formula Restoration phrase, which functions such as the master essential to all of your accounts. Produce down this phrase and retail outlet it in a secure, protected spot. Usually do not store it digitally or share it with anyone. 

Leave a Reply

Your email address will not be published. Required fields are marked *